Miniature un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V). Researcher examines components within the 'Mirador' miniature UAV. Mirador was designed by the French defence research agency ONERA and the Belgium Royal Military Academy of Brussels. This UAV is a fixed-wing propeller-driven aircraft powered by a fuel cell. It measures 25 centimetres long and can fly for 20 minutes. Miniature UAV aircraft equipped with small cameras and other sensors are being designed for military and civilian surveillance.
